About this listen

Go beyond the box scores and talking-head hype as Arky Shea and Joel C. Cordes break down the NBA's biggest on-court storylines. Get the full context and nuances of pro basketball while meeting up-and-coming content creators and experiencing a behind-the-scenes look at sports media.
